1287 - Element Appearing More Than 25% In Sorted Array\.
Easy
Given an integer array **sorted** in non-decreasing order, there is exactly one integer in the array that occurs more than 25% of the time, return that integer.
**Example 1:**
**Input:** arr = [1,2,2,6,6,6,6,7,10]
**Output:** 6
**Example 2:**
**Input:** arr = [1,1]
**Output:** 1
**Constraints:**
*
1 <= arr.length <= 104
* 0 <= arr[i] <= 105-
